Engine
The engine was a Air cooled cooled Four stroke, V twin, longitudinally mounted, OHV, 4 valves per cylinder.. The engine featured a 9.7:1 compression ratio.
Drive
Power was moderated via the Single plate, dry type.
Chassis
It came with a 100/90 V18 front tire and a 120/90 V18 rear tire. Stopping was achieved via 2x 270mm discs in the front and a Single 235mm disc in the rear. The front suspension was a Moto Guzzi hydropneumatic telescopic forks with pressure equalizer while the rear was equipped with a Swinging fork, light alloy die-casting with Koni adjustable shock absorbers. The 750 Strada was fitted with a 16 Liters / 4.2 US gal fuel tank. The bike weighed just 185 kg / 408 lbs.

Moto Guzzi 750 Strada
Make Model | Moto Guzzi 750 Strada |
---|---|
Year | 1989 - |
Engine Type | Four stroke, V twin, longitudinally mounted, OHV, 4 valves per cylinder. |
Displacement | 744 cc / 45.3 cu-in |
Bore X Stroke | 80 x 74 mm |
Cooling System | Air cooled |
Compression | 9.7:1 |
Lubrication | Pressure pump |
Induction | 2x 30mm PHBH Dell'Orto carburetors |
Ignition | Electronic motoplat double pick-up |
Starting | Electric |
Max Pawer | 48 hp / 35 kW @ 6600 rpm |
Max Torque | 59.4 Nm / 6.06 kgf-m @ 5600 rpm |
Clutch | Single plate, dry type |
Transmission | 5 Speed |
Final Drive | Shaft |
Frame | Steel tubular duplex cradle, disassemblable |
Front Suspension | Moto Guzzi hydropneumatic telescopic forks with pressure equalizer |
Rear Suspension | Swinging fork, light alloy die-casting with Koni adjustable shock absorbers |
Front Brakes | 2x 270mm discs |
Rear Brakes | Single 235mm disc |
Wheels | Light alloy casting |
Front Tire | 100/90 V18 |
Rear Tire | 120/90 V18 |
Seat Height | 730 mm / 28.7 in |
Dry Weight | 185 kg / 408 lbs |
Fuel Capacity | 16 Liters / 4.2 US gal |
